Output 3c77801f0b430fcaaab5a34cee63813172ccf4d68a4417985a3923617203f103:0

value
380681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2409b1a6d536af63b981d49009069da661bc7469 OP_EQUAL
address
34yZrznxQsHRgyKKoytAHkSky9iBKGysBz
transaction
3c77801f0b430fcaaab5a34cee63813172ccf4d68a4417985a3923617203f103